Uk spec of the products are 1500 - 2000 grit sand paper, g3 cutting paste, and a buffer with a compound head, All you do is flat carefully with your sandpaper using water this wil ensure your paintwork is smoothdry off yuraim is to get all imperfections out including any orange peel! repeat if necessary, add some g3 to your buffer then compound the required area, wipe off with a soft cloth, polish and voila, email me from my site if you need any further assistance and will you please check my links as they earn me cash, thanks mate
